Output 75b8c4a55ec82625541042a02102466bbfe6309f3836683d40b699797a2a6f5d:30
- value
- 43877250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1477bc5f63352db34c9191d7873dba76ad211eba OP_EQUAL
- address
- 33ZEsmiJJs3N5VEg2RRfis2CK4gYDq19Ke
- transaction
- 75b8c4a55ec82625541042a02102466bbfe6309f3836683d40b699797a2a6f5d
- confirmations
- 353316
- spent
- true